This year Barnes & Noble is having a new event called Discovery Friday. Taking place a week before Black Friday, Discovery Friday gives shoppers a chance to take advantage of some unique one-day deals on books like “101 Dog Tricks” and “Chaser.” “101 Dog Tricks” is a step-by-step guide with color pictures that any dog lover can use to bond through trick training with their dog. “Chaser” is the story of the border collie who knows over a thousand words, which is more than any other non-human animal.
